The modular structure of insulin-receptor substrates IRS-1 and IRS-2. This schematic view represents the amino acid sequence common to IRS-1 and IRS-2. Each protein contains a pleckstrin homology domain (which binds phosphoinositide lipids), a phosphotyrosine-binding domain, and four sequences that approximate Tyr-X-X-Met (YXXM). The four sequences are phosphorylated by the insulin-receptor tyrosine kinase.
